Strong uniqueness of solutions of stochastic differential equations with jumps and non-Lipschitz random coefficients
Анотація
In the paper we establish strong uniqueness of solution of a system of stochastic differential equations with random non-Lipschitz coefficients that involve both the square integrable continuous vector martingales and centered and non-centered Poisson measures.
